When suctioning the respiratory tract of a client, it is recommended that the suctioning period not exceed how many seconds?
- A. 5 seconds.
- B. 10 seconds.
- C. 15 seconds.
- D. 20 seconds.
Correct Answer: C
Rationale: Suctioning should not exceed 15 seconds to prevent hypoxia and trauma to the airway.

The nurse is caring for a client with a suspected urinary tract infection. Which symptom is most common?
- A. Dysuria
- B. Flank pain
- C. Hematuria
- D. Nocturia
Correct Answer: A
Rationale: Dysuria (painful urination) is the most common symptom of a urinary tract infection, reflecting bladder or urethral irritation.
The nurse notices drops of a liquid on the hallway floor of a health care facility. The nurse should do which of the following first?
- A. Place paper towels over the drops of liquid.
- B. Don clean gloves and wipe up the drops of liquid.
- C. Post 'wet floor' signs around the area.
- D. Call the Environmental Services Department.
Correct Answer: C
Rationale: Posting 'wet floor' signs first ensures immediate safety by alerting others to the hazard, preventing slips. Then, the nurse can proceed with cleanup or notify appropriate personnel.
A postoperative client has a Jackson-Pratt drain. Which finding should the nurse report immediately?
- A. Clear, serous drainage.
- B. Bright red drainage of 50 mL in 2 hours.
- C. Slight swelling around the drain site.
- D. Drainage with a foul odor.
Correct Answer: B
Rationale: Bright red drainage suggests active bleeding, a serious complication requiring immediate reporting.

A client with a history of chronic kidney disease is prescribed sodium polystyrene sulfonate (Kayexalate). The nurse should explain that this medication works by:
- A. Reducing blood pressure.
- B. Binding potassium in the gut.
- C. Increasing urine output.
- D. Decreasing blood glucose.
Correct Answer: B
Rationale: Sodium polystyrene sulfonate binds potassium in the gut, reducing serum potassium levels in chronic kidney disease.
